    ★ Who are we?
    We're Chad and Zaynah Miner! For the past two-something years we have been traveling the U.S. in our tiny home on wheels with our two cats, Tavi and Akina. The main reason we are living in a van was to get out of our crushing rent in Boulder, Colorado and re-gain our freedom and time. Chad has been a professional photographer aiming to make his side hustle his main hustle for several years now, and van life has given him the opportunity to make this transition (which is super exciting!!). Zaynah has always dreamed of living minimally, traveling as much as possible, and living in a tiny home off grid somewhere with a fully sustainable setup. We plan to continue traveling for the next few years in our van home to save for our long term goal of a sustainable home on our own land - so please subscribe and join the adventure! We also have over 200 videos of our time traveling full time in a skoolie conversion so if you want to see the various vehicles we've lived in check that out under the playlists tab. All the best xx

    Stay strong and stand your ground. You didn't do anything wrong. If they don't want to look at vehicles parked on the main road, they shouldn't have bought a house that's along the main road. People like that make me sick. I'm a truck driver in utah. They have restricted engine brakes at the bottom of Parley's Canyon because people decided to build homes right next to freeway and they don't like the noise. My rig weighs 105,000 lbs when I have both trailers on. I have to use my engine brakes or my regular brakes will fail and then I'll have a run away truck. I'm tired of having to fight tickets because others are selfish and want everyone else to change just because they moved there. Every time I fight the ticket, I win. Definitely fight your ticket! It won't be hard to win!
